Vehicle Description 2011 Jaguar xkr175 Coupe.
In honor of Jaguar's 75th anniversary, the company has worked up a limited run of XKR coupes, dubbed XKR175.
The 175 stands for 175-car, the total production What the 175 should stand for is the car's top speed.
The standard XKR is electronically limited to 155 mph, but the XKR175 raises that speed limit all the way to174 mph.
Uh, come on, guys.
You couldn't bump it up 1 more? The XKR175 package adds Absolute Black paint; more extreme front and rear spoilers, lower body extensions, and rear diffuser; and red brake calipers that peek out from behind special, ten-spoke 20-inch wheels.
Inside, there's charcoal leather with dark red stitching, black veneers, and door sill plates that say, XKR175 - 1 of 175 A new, aluminum-block, 5.
0-liter V-8, introduced for 2011, with 510 hp and 461 pound-feet of torque.
A quick shove of the gas pedal is all it takes to fast-forward the scenery, to the accompaniment of a nice, subdued growl rather than a supercharger whine.
Jaguar advertises a 0-to-60 time of 4.
6 seconds.
Happily, the R-spec brakes scrub off speed in a hurry.
The six-speed automatic, with standard shift paddles, is so quick, so rev-matching racy, and so smooth around town, that you'll never wish for a dual-clutch gearbox again.
